Calling Me

Calling Me

written by: Aaron McMillan

@PoetryontheMind

 

I’m opposite you, holding back,
The calm summer night, lets me hear your words,
You’re like an angel on attack,
Waving your wings at me like a beautiful bird.

Whispering, softly to me,
Come closer, come closer,
Once there with you I’ll be a detainee,
How will you get me to come over?

I have to give it to you,
You stopped me on my way,
Simply walking on through,
Such an enticing offer you portray.

With the moon at your back,
So bright and true,
You might think I’ll crack,
But I’m just passing through.

Like slow motion, you beckon me to come,
With your long wavy hair and wandering eyes,
Thankfully your look makes me feel numb,
I’m coming with you, don’t look so surprised.
